Benefits of Massage Chairs
Massage chairs offer a convenient and great way to alleviate stress and tension in the comfort of your own home. After a tiring day, plunging into a massage chair can help alleviate built-up tension in your muscles, promoting relaxation and enhancing your overall well-being. The gentle kneading and rhythmic motions provided by these chairs simulate the techniques of a professional massage therapist, making it easier to unwind and disconnect from daily pressures.
In moreover to relaxation, massage chairs can contribute to improved circulation. The various massage techniques utilized by these chairs encourage better blood flow, which can help deliver oxygen and nutrients to the muscles and tissues. This improvement in circulation can be particularly beneficial for individuals who maintain a sedentary lifestyle or spend long hours sitting at a desk, as it aids in reducing fatigue and promoting rejuvenation.
Another noteworthy benefit of massage recliners is their ability to alleviate pain and discomfort. Many users find relief from conditions such as lower back pain, neck stiffness, and muscle soreness through frequent use. By targeting specific pressure points and providing deep tissue massage, these chairs can help break the cycle of pain and tension, allowing users to enjoy a more pleasant and active lifestyle.
Types of Massage Chairs
Massage seating options come in different designs and styles to cater to specific needs and preferences. Traditional massage chairs typically focus on a fundamental roller mechanism that targets the back, shoulders, and neck. These chairs typically offer a restricted range of massage functions but are perfect for individuals looking for simple relief from stress and discomfort. Their straightforward operation makes them easy to use for first-time users and those who like a straightforward experience.
In comparison, advanced massage chairs include a wide array of features, such as zero gravity positioning, body scanning technology, and various massage techniques like rub, tapping, and shiatsu. These chairs aim to provide a comprehensive wellness experience by not only treating muscle tension but also promoting calm and enhanced circulation. Users can tailor their massage experience to target specific areas like the lumbar region, thighs, and feet, making them ideal for those with persistent discomfort or high stress levels.
There are also portable massage chairs designed for easy transport and versatility. These easy-to-carry options are perfect for users who want to enjoy a massage on the go, whether at home, in the office, or during traveling. While they may not offer the extensive features of larger chairs, they still provide significant relief and relaxation through targeted massage techniques. Their small design and ease of setup make them suitable for individuals wanting intermittent relief without committing to a larger purchase.
